Output 003feb3daf11f287c61b97c371df8ea86d08ae2f7799b8ed8d493d16de2ce7bd:0

value
23740932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be150881f820276cac86016592e2447c6bc37cf OP_EQUAL
address
34ES5rWbkooCC4TbXZKHZ6En8wwhXv1vnc
transaction
003feb3daf11f287c61b97c371df8ea86d08ae2f7799b8ed8d493d16de2ce7bd
spent
true